Imee Marcos slams PNP chief, wants return of VP Duterte’s security

MANILA, Philippines — Senator Imee Marcos condemned the removal of Vice President Sara Duterte’s 75 police security detail, demanding that it be reinstated as soon as possible.

In a statement posted on her social media account on Tuesday, Marcos explained why Duterte’s security detail should be brought back.

“First, she is the second highest elected official in the country whose safety must never be compromised. Second, she is a Duterte, who, like her father, is a staunch defender of law and order, hence topping the Communist Party of the Philippines-New People’s Army’s order of battle,” said Marcos.

The senator then proceeded to lambast Philippine National Police (PNP) chief Rommel Marbil, who ordered the transfer of 75 police officers from Duterte’s personal protection detail to other assignments, particularly in Metro Manila.

“At sino naman ‘yang Rommel Marbil? Ni hindi ko nga ‘yan kilala,” said Marcos.

(Who’s this Rommel Marbil? I don’t even know him.)

Duterte earlier described the recall of her security detail as a “clear case of political harassment.”

To recall, the country’s second top official posted a four-page letter on her Facebook page slamming Marbil for allegedly lying about the withdrawal of her police protection detail.

For his part, Marbil maintained that Duterte’s security team was reduced because no threat against her had been observed.

This, however, did not sit well with Duterte, who proceeded to ask the PNP chief how he defines a threat.

“Ano ba ang ibig sabihin ng ‘threat’ sa iyo? Ang banta ba ay maaari lamang magmula sa mga external elements? Hindi na ba ‘threat’ kung ang harassment ay nanggagaling mismo sa mga tauhan ng gobyerno?” Duterte asked.

(What does “threat” mean to you? Can threats only come from external elements? Isn’t it a “threat” if the harassment comes from government personnel?)

“Tandaan mo, pagdating sa seguridad ng aking pamilya, ako ang magsasabi kung sino ang karapat-dapat, hindi ikaw. Batas ka lang, hindi ka Diyos,” she added.

(Remember, when it comes to my family’s security, I get to say who deserves it, not you. You are just the law, not God.)
